This syndrome has been called the nephron nephrosis Distal Tubular Disease Acute generally recognized three major pathophysiological mechanisms in clinical development: 1) blood or tissue destruction with release of nephrotoxic elements. 2) vascular collapse with hypotension and arterial prograsiva, and electroitos metabolic alterations. 3) sensitivity or awareness of certain parenchyma and kidney preferentially to various insults of altered metabolism or microbial toxins or certain chemicals and drugs.
